Saffron may be a little pricey, but after you taste this pasta dish, you won't regret a single penny!
You'll need:
- 1 teaspoon saffron threads
- olive oil
- 1 onion, chopped
- 1 tablespoon fresh or dried thyme, chopped
- 1 1/4 pounds sweet Italian turkey sausage
- 1 1/2 cups heavy cream
- 1 pound pasta (rigatoni, penne, gluten-free)
- salt and pepper
- parsley
- Parmesan cheese
Here’s how to make it:
- In large, nonstick pan, heat olive oil. Sauté chopped onions with thyme, salt and pepper.
- Once onion is soft, about 6 minutes, add sausage and break up as it cooks, another 6 minutes.
- Add cream, saffron threads and a generous pinch of salt. Bring to a rolling simmer and cook until slightly reduced. Cover and let sit. (Let it sit until cool and then bring it back to a simmer before serving. It lets the sauce settle.)
- When ready to eat, bring a pot of water to boil and cook pasta until al dente. Mix sauce into pasta and top with grated Parmesan cheese and parsley.
